I bought an ASUS laptop a few months back, and I'm experiencing some issues while playing games. I've only played a few games, but every time I encounter the same problem, about every 10 seconds like clockwork, the frame rate drops. I've used fraps to see the fps, and it's happened in every game I played (Life is strange, CS GO and a Castlevania game). It seems to have no importance what settings i run the game on.
The laptop is an ASUS x550L, with i7 processor, 8 gigs of ram and an NVIDIA 820m. The drivers are up to date, i've set that all the programs start on the dedicated graphics by default, and only game while it's on it's charger.

Well, the 820M isnt a weak GPU, I've a lot of GTA V experience on it, but don't use FRAPS to check FPS. I'd not bother checking FPS while gaming, FRAPS is known to reduce FPS a lot. The other reason can be heating. From my experience, i've known that the card heats up upto 94 degrees under heavy gaming load. This could cause throttling making the GPU run slower.
